Customized software is a unique type of software that is designed to meet the specific needs of a particular organization or individual. Unlike off-the-shelf software, which is designed to be used by a wide range of users, customized software is tailored to the specific requirements of a particular user or group of users. This can include features and functionality that are not available in off-the-shelf software, as well as a user interface that is designed to be easy to use for the intended users.
Customized software can provide a number of benefits for organizations, including increased efficiency, productivity, and profitability. By automating tasks and processes, customized software can free up employees to focus on other tasks that require human interaction. Additionally, customized software can help organizations to improve their customer service by providing them with the tools they need to better track and manage customer interactions.
The development of customized software has a long history, dating back to the early days of computing. In the early days, customized software was often developed by in-house IT departments. However, as the cost of software development has decreased, it has become more common for organizations to outsource the development of customized software to specialized software development companies.
customized software
Customized software has become increasingly important for businesses of all sizes. It can provide a number of benefits, including increased efficiency, productivity, and profitability. Here are 10 key aspects of customized software that businesses should consider when making a decision about whether or not to invest in it:
- Tailor-made: Customized software is designed to meet the specific needs of a particular organization or individual.
- Flexibility: Customized software can be easily modified to meet changing business needs.
- Scalability: Customized software can be scaled up or down to meet the needs of a growing business.
- Integration: Customized software can be integrated with other software systems to create a seamless workflow.
- Security: Customized software can be designed with specific security features to protect sensitive data.
- Cost-effective: Customized software can be a cost-effective solution for businesses that need software that is tailored to their specific needs.
- Competitive advantage: Customized software can give businesses a competitive advantage by providing them with unique features and functionality.
- Improved customer service: Customized software can help businesses to improve their customer service by providing them with the tools they need to better track and manage customer interactions.
- Increased employee productivity: Customized software can help employees to be more productive by automating tasks and processes.
- Better decision-making: Customized software can provide businesses with the data and insights they need to make better decisions.
When considering customized software, it is important to remember that it is not a one-size-fits-all solution. The best customized software will be designed to meet the specific needs of your business. By taking the time to understand your business needs and objectives, you can make an informed decision about whether or not customized software is right for you.
Tailor-made
As a component of customized software, “tailor-made” is of utmost importance. It underscores the fundamental principle that customized software is not a one-size-fits-all solution. Instead, it is meticulously crafted to align seamlessly with the unique requirements of each organization or individual. This tailored approach ensures that the software perfectly complements the user’s specific workflow, processes, and objectives.
Consider the example of a healthcare provider seeking customized software to manage patient records and streamline operations. Off-the-shelf software may offer generic features that cater to a broad range of healthcare settings. However, customized software can be tailored to meet the specific needs of this particular provider, incorporating specialized modules for managing patient appointments, tracking medical history, and generating customized treatment plans. This tailored approach enhances efficiency, improves accuracy, and ultimately leads to better patient care.
The practical significance of understanding the connection between “tailor-made” and “customized software” lies in the ability to make informed decisions about software solutions. By recognizing that customized software is tailored to specific needs, organizations can avoid the pitfalls of generic software that may not fully align with their unique requirements. This understanding empowers businesses to invest wisely in software solutions that will drive tangible improvements in productivity, efficiency, and overall success.
Flexibility
In the realm of software solutions, adaptability is paramount. The ability to seamlessly adapt to evolving business needs is a hallmark of customized software, setting it apart from its off-the-shelf counterparts. This flexibility empowers businesses to stay agile, innovative, and responsive in the face of dynamic market conditions.
- Tailored Modifications: Unlike rigid, pre-packaged software, customized software can be effortlessly modified to align with specific business requirements. This malleability allows organizations to fine-tune the software to match their unique processes, workflows, and industry-specific nuances.
- Dynamic Scaling: As businesses grow and evolve, their software needs inevitably change. Customized software provides the flexibility to scale up or down effortlessly, accommodating changing user numbers, data volumes, and functional requirements. This scalability ensures that the software remains a valuable asset throughout the organization’s growth journey.
- Seamless Integrations: The ability to integrate with other software systems is crucial for businesses operating in complex ecosystems. Customized software can be seamlessly integrated with existing applications, databases, and platforms, enabling the free flow of data and eliminating the need for manual data entry or redundant processes.
- Continuous Improvement: The flexibility of customized software empowers businesses to continuously improve their software solutions. As new requirements emerge or user feedback is gathered, modifications can be made swiftly and efficiently, ensuring that the software remains aligned with the organization’s evolving needs.
The flexibility of customized software is not merely a technical capability but a strategic advantage. By embracing adaptable software solutions, businesses can foster innovation, streamline operations, and gain a competitive edge in today’s rapidly changing business landscape.
Scalability
In the ever-evolving business landscape, adaptability is key. Customized software stands out as a champion of adaptability, offering businesses the scalability to grow and thrive without software limitations. This scalability is a cornerstone of customized software, empowering businesses to seamlessly adjust their software solutions to meet the dynamic demands of the market.
Consider a start-up company that has developed a customized software solution to manage customer orders and inventory. As the company grows and expands its operations, the software needs to keep pace. With customized software, the company can effortlessly scale up the solution to accommodate the increasing number of orders, product lines, and customers. This ensures uninterrupted operations and continued business growth without software constraints.
Conversely, as business needs change or market conditions fluctuate, customized software provides the flexibility to scale down. The company can easily reduce the software’s capacity to match the decreased demand, optimizing costs and ensuring efficient resource allocation. This scalability safeguards the company from overspending on software that exceeds their current needs.
The practical significance of understanding the connection between scalability and customized software lies in the ability to make informed decisions about software solutions. By recognizing the scalability of customized software, businesses can avoid the pitfalls of rigid, off-the-shelf software that may not accommodate their changing needs. This understanding empowers businesses to invest in software solutions that will grow and adapt alongside their business, driving long-term success.
Integration
In the interconnected world of business software, integration is paramount. Customized software shines in this regard, offering businesses the ability to seamlessly integrate with other software systems, creating a cohesive and efficient workflow. This integration capability is a key component of customized software, enabling businesses to streamline operations, eliminate data silos, and enhance productivity.
Consider a manufacturing company that uses customized software to manage its production processes. This software can be integrated with the company’s inventory management system, enabling real-time updates on raw material availability and finished goods inventory levels. Additionally, integration with the company’s customer relationship management (CRM) system allows for seamless order processing and customer communication. This integration creates a seamless flow of information across different departments and systems, reducing errors, improving collaboration, and increasing overall efficiency.
The practical significance of understanding the connection between integration and customized software lies in the ability to make informed decisions about software solutions. By recognizing the integration capabilities of customized software, businesses can avoid the pitfalls of isolated software systems that hinder communication and data sharing. This understanding empowers businesses to invest in software solutions that will foster collaboration, streamline operations, and drive business growth.
Security
In the digital age, data security is of paramount importance. Customized software plays a vital role in safeguarding sensitive information by providing robust security features tailored to the specific needs of businesses and individuals. Let’s delve into the connection between security and customized software, exploring its key facets and implications.
- Tailored Security Measures: Unlike generic software, customized software can be designed with specific security features that address the unique vulnerabilities and threats faced by a particular organization or individual. This tailored approach ensures that sensitive data is protected against unauthorized access, data breaches, and cyberattacks.
- Encryption and Data Protection: Customized software can incorporate advanced encryption algorithms to protect data at rest and in transit. This encryption ensures that even if unauthorized individuals gain access to data, it remains unreadable without the proper decryption key.
- Authentication and Authorization: Customized software can implement multi-factor authentication and role-based access controls to restrict access to sensitive data only to authorized users. This layered approach strengthens security by verifying user identities and limiting access based on predefined permissions.
- Security Audits and Monitoring: Customized software can be designed with built-in security audit trails and monitoring mechanisms. These features allow organizations to track user activities, identify suspicious behavior, and respond promptly to security incidents.
The significance of understanding the connection between security and customized software lies in the ability to make informed decisions about software solutions. Recognizing the importance of data security, businesses and individuals can choose customized software that provides the necessary protection against evolving cyber threats. This investment in security safeguards sensitive information, maintains compliance with regulations, and fosters trust among customers and stakeholders.
Cost-effective
The cost-effectiveness of customized software is a key factor that contributes to its popularity among businesses. Unlike off-the-shelf software, which may require extensive customization to meet specific requirements, customized software is designed from the ground up to align with the unique needs of an organization. This eliminates the need for costly modifications and ensures that businesses only pay for the features and functionality they require.
Additionally, customized software can lead to significant cost savings in the long run. By automating tasks and streamlining processes, customized software can free up employees to focus on more strategic initiatives. This increased efficiency can lead to reduced labor costs and improved productivity, resulting in a positive impact on the bottom line.
For example, a manufacturing company may invest in customized software to manage its production processes. This software can be designed to automate inventory management, track production schedules, and generate reports. By eliminating manual processes and reducing errors, the company can significantly reduce its operating costs and improve its overall profitability.
Understanding the connection between cost-effectiveness and customized software is crucial for businesses looking to optimize their software investments. By choosing customized software that is tailored to their specific needs, businesses can avoid unnecessary expenses and achieve a higher return on investment.
Competitive advantage
In today’s fiercely competitive business landscape, customized software has emerged as a powerful tool for organizations seeking to gain an edge over their rivals. By harnessing the ability to tailor software solutions to their specific needs, businesses can unlock unique features and functionality that set them apart from their competitors and drive their success.
- Differentiation: Customized software allows businesses to differentiate themselves from competitors by offering unique features and functionality that cater to their specific target market. This differentiation can create a strong brand identity and make it more difficult for competitors to replicate their success.
- Operational efficiency: By automating tasks and streamlining processes, customized software can help businesses improve their operational efficiency. This can lead to reduced costs, increased productivity, and improved customer satisfaction.
- Innovation: Customized software can serve as a platform for innovation, allowing businesses to explore new ideas and develop cutting-edge solutions. This can lead to the creation of new products and services, as well as the improvement of existing ones.
- Customer loyalty: By providing customers with unique and tailored experiences, customized software can help businesses build customer loyalty and increase repeat business. This can lead to increased revenue and long-term profitability.
Understanding the connection between competitive advantage and customized software is crucial for businesses looking to stay ahead in the market. By investing in customized software solutions, businesses can gain access to unique features and functionality that can help them differentiate themselves from competitors, improve their operational efficiency, drive innovation, and build customer loyalty.
Improved customer service
In today’s competitive business landscape, providing excellent customer service is essential for businesses to succeed. Customized software can be a powerful tool for businesses to enhance their customer service capabilities and build stronger relationships with their customers.
- Personalized experiences: Customized software allows businesses to create personalized experiences for each customer. By tracking customer preferences and behavior, businesses can tailor their interactions to meet the individual needs of each customer, leading to increased satisfaction and loyalty.
- Efficient communication: Customized software can streamline communication between businesses and their customers. By providing a centralized platform for managing customer inquiries, businesses can respond to customers more quickly and efficiently, resolving issues and building stronger relationships.
- Real-time insights: Customized software can provide businesses with real-time insights into customer behavior and preferences. This information can be used to identify areas for improvement and develop targeted marketing campaigns, leading to increased sales and customer satisfaction.
- Proactive support: Customized software can enable businesses to provide proactive support to their customers. By analyzing customer data, businesses can identify potential problems and offer solutions before they become major issues, reducing customer churn and building trust.
By leveraging the power of customized software, businesses can transform their customer service operations, improve customer satisfaction, and build lasting relationships with their customers.
Increased employee productivity
Customized software plays a pivotal role in boosting employee productivity by automating repetitive and time-consuming tasks. By eliminating manual processes, employees can focus their efforts on more strategic and value-added activities that drive business growth. Let’s delve into the connection between increased employee productivity and customized software, exploring its significance and practical implications.
Imagine a scenario where a sales team spends a significant amount of time manually generating proposals and sending follow-up emails to potential customers. Customized software can automate these tasks, freeing up the sales team to engage in more meaningful activities such as building relationships with clients, identifying new sales opportunities, and closing deals. This leads to increased productivity, higher sales conversion rates, and improved customer satisfaction.
The practical significance of understanding this connection lies in the ability to make informed decisions about software solutions. By recognizing the potential for increased employee productivity, businesses can prioritize investments in customized software that automates tasks and streamlines processes. This strategic approach empowers employees to focus on high-value activities that contribute to the organization’s overall success.
In conclusion, customized software is a powerful tool for increasing employee productivity. By automating tasks and processes, employees can dedicate their time and energy to more strategic initiatives, driving business growth and innovation. Embracing customized software solutions is a key step towards optimizing workforce efficiency and achieving long-term success.
Better decision-making
Customized software empowers businesses to make informed decisions by providing them with valuable data and insights. Unlike generic software, which offers limited data analysis capabilities, customized software is tailored to the specific needs of an organization, enabling it to collect, analyze, and present data in a meaningful way.
For instance, a retail company can implement customized software to track customer behavior, sales patterns, and inventory levels. This data can be analyzed to identify trends, predict demand, and optimize pricing strategies. By leveraging these insights, the company can make data-driven decisions that lead to increased sales, reduced costs, and improved customer satisfaction.
The practical significance of understanding this connection lies in the ability to recognize the value of data-driven decision-making. By investing in customized software that provides robust data analysis capabilities, businesses can gain a competitive edge by making informed decisions based on real-time data and actionable insights.
FAQs About Customized Software
Customized software solutions offer a wide range of benefits for businesses, but they can also raise questions. Here are answers to some frequently asked questions about customized software:
Question 1: What is the difference between customized software and off-the-shelf software?
Customized software is designed and developed to meet the specific needs of a particular organization or individual, while off-the-shelf software is a pre-packaged solution that is designed for a wide range of users. Customized software offers greater flexibility and can be tailored to the unique requirements of a business, but it can also be more expensive than off-the-shelf software.
Question 2: What are the benefits of using customized software?
Customized software can provide a number of benefits for businesses, including increased efficiency, productivity, and profitability. It can also help businesses to improve their customer service, gain a competitive advantage, and make better decisions.
Question 3: How much does customized software cost?
The cost of customized software can vary depending on the size and complexity of the project. However, it is important to remember that customized software is an investment that can save businesses money in the long run by improving efficiency and productivity.
Question 4: How long does it take to develop customized software?
The time it takes to develop customized software can vary depending on the size and complexity of the project. However, most projects can be completed within a few months to a year.
Question 5: How can I find a reputable customized software developer?
There are a number of ways to find a reputable customized software developer. One option is to ask for recommendations from other businesses that have used customized software. Another option is to search for developers online or in industry directories.
Question 6: What are the risks of using customized software?
There are some risks associated with using customized software, such as the potential for errors or delays in development. However, these risks can be mitigated by choosing a reputable developer and by carefully managing the development process.
Overall, customized software can be a valuable investment for businesses of all sizes. By understanding the benefits and risks involved, businesses can make informed decisions about whether or not to invest in customized software.
Transition to the next article section:
Next Section: Benefits of Customized Software
Tips for Using Customized Software
Customized software offers a wide range of benefits for businesses, but it is important to use it effectively to get the most out of your investment. Here are a few tips to help you get started:
Tip 1: Define Your Needs
Before you start looking for customized software, take some time to define your needs. What are you trying to achieve with the software? What are your must-have features? What are your nice-to-have features? Once you have a clear understanding of your needs, you can start to look for software that is a good fit.
Tip 2: Do Your Research
There are a number of different customized software vendors out there, so it is important to do your research before you make a decision. Read reviews, talk to other businesses that have used customized software, and compare pricing. This will help you find a vendor that is reputable and has a good track record.
Tip 3: Get a Demo
Once you have found a few vendors that you are interested in, ask for a demo. This will give you a chance to see the software in action and ask any questions that you have. Demos are also a great way to get a feel for the vendor’s customer service.
Tip 4: Negotiate Your Contract
Once you have chosen a vendor, it is important to negotiate your contract carefully. Make sure that the contract includes all of the features and services that you need, and that the pricing is fair. You should also make sure that the contract includes a warranty and a support agreement.
Tip 5: Implement the Software Carefully
Once you have purchased customized software, it is important to implement it carefully. This includes training your employees on how to use the software, and making sure that the software is integrated with your other business systems. Proper implementation will help you to get the most out of your investment.
Summary
Customized software can be a valuable investment for businesses of all sizes. By following these tips, you can increase your chances of success when using customized software.
Customized Software
In this article, we have explored the world of customized software, uncovering its unique benefits and transformative potential for businesses. From increased efficiency and productivity to improved customer service and competitive advantage, customized software offers a tailored solution to meet the specific needs of any organization.
As we look to the future, customized software will continue to play a pivotal role in driving business success. By embracing the power of customization, businesses can unlock new opportunities, gain a competitive edge, and achieve their full potential.